11. Clean windows and mirrors without leaving streaks

25 Magical Uses of Household Alcohol Nobody Knows About.

To have perfectly clean and streak-free windows, household alcohol is a great ally!

To make a homemade glass cleaner that leaves NO streaks, the recipe is very simple.

Pour into an empty spray 4 tablespoons of rubbing alcohol, 4 tablespoons of white vinegar and a glass of water.

You can add 10 drops of essential oil (optional).

Spray your product on dirty windows and mirrors and wipe with a clean microfiber cloth.

There you go, your windows are now flawless, transparent and streak-free.

White vinegar makes them shine and rubbing alcohol removes traces.

In addition, it prevents dust and water drops from settling again, leaving a protective film. Check out the trick here.

19. Disinfect the fridge

25 Magical Uses of Household Alcohol Nobody Knows About.

The fridge is certainly the household appliance that needs to be cleaned most regularly.

Normal, since we keep our food there, we don't want bacteria to settle there!

Here's a great trick to clean and disinfect the fridge in one go.

Make a paste by mixing 2 tablespoons rubbing alcohol, 3 tablespoons baking soda and 10 drops lemon essential oil.

Mix well to obtain a homogeneous paste.

Put it on the non-abrasive part of a clean sponge and pass it on the walls of the fridge, the shelves and the compartments.

Then rinse with clear, warm water to remove small residues.

For an impeccable finish, you can finish by passing a microfiber cloth. Find out how here.

You can also mix equal parts water and household alcohol and use this mixture to clean the inside and outside of the fridge:shelves, walls, door, handle...

Simply soak a sponge or cloth in the mixture and clean with the interior and exterior of the fridge after emptying it.

Finish by wiping with a dry cloth. Easy and effective!

What is household alcohol?

25 Magical Uses of Household Alcohol Nobody Knows About.

Household alcohol is a mixture of methylated spirits, ethanol, methanol and disinfectant.

Thus, its smell is not too strong and it can be used without a mask, unlike ammonia.

Sometimes synthetic perfume is also added:vanilla, lemon, strawberry, raspberry...

You can find it in different degrees:90° or 70°, a bit like the alcohol you buy in pharmacies.

What is the difference between rubbing alcohol and household alcohol?

As we have just seen, rubbing alcohol is part of the composition of household alcohol.

Indeed, household alcohol is made up of 3/4 methylated spirits. So it's denatured methylated spirit!

Why ? To reduce the particularly strong and unpleasant smell of rubbing alcohol.

Household alcohol should also not be confused with household vinegar which is just another name for white vinegar.

Precautions for use

If you don't take a few precautions, household alcohol can be harmful.

Here's how to use it so that this product is safe for your health and risk-free.

- Household alcohol should only be used externally. It is toxic internally.

- Always store your bottle of household alcohol out of the reach of children and pets. Or store it in a secure closet.

- Better to wear household gloves when using household alcohol. Indeed, it is best to avoid contact with the skin.

- Avoid contact with eyes. In case of contact with eyes, rinse with plenty of clean water for several minutes and consult a doctor.

- Never use rubbing alcohol near a flame. It is a flammable product.

- Avoid breathing household alcohol fumes.

- After using rubbing alcohol, ventilate the room well. Otherwise, the fumes released can make your head spin. For this reason, pregnant women are recommended not to use it.

- Never mix rubbing alcohol with bleach. These two products should not come into contact.

- Remember to close the bottle of rubbing alcohol tightly after use to prevent evaporation.

- Do not use household alcohol to clean the TV, computer equipment, HIFI, video or glasses.
